What are the advantages of the HDCamSR signal processing?
a) it records the 4:4:4 RGB HD signals practically without compression.
b) It can fully replace the formerly known 2k signal processing with the plus that it can be real time recorded on a cassette.
c) It is fully compatible with the worldwide spread HDCam System
d) It is expected to be the HD signal processing of the future
What had to be changed to install the HDCamSR technology?
Practically everything or more exactly because of making the coming HD world easier we decided to change more that was needed. We implemented 6 different routers to be able to handle the very complex signal flow. The HDCamSR signal for example is carried through a dual link connection so it needs a double signal processing.
We made completely new cabelling around the whole studio. We concentrated all the machines into a big central machinery room to make the transfer activities more efficient. With the help of the routers every machine can be contacted with any other one.

New services in Focus-Fox
*) We changed our good old Spirit telecine into brand new Spirit 2 that is equipped with HD output (capable of 4:4:4 RGB signal flow). More and more customers ask for HD processing, for two reasons. On one hand post in HD gives better result even if the signal will be downconverted to SD at the end of the post. The programs finished in HD can be recorded onto film for film release with better quality. On the other hand many big TV stations ask for HD copy of every new programme even there is no HDTV transmission yet. The grading in HD can be more careful as the DOP sees much more details than in SD. To help the job we installed a 1.2 meter wide rear projector in the telecine suite. The overall look of the picture is much better than in SD.
The projector also helps at DI (Digital Intermediate) works because the viewing feeling is similar to the cinema one.
*) We upgraded our Inferno workstation to a most up-to-date Flame workstation. This is now the top product of the market leader Discreet Logic (Autodesk Multimedia). Of course it is able to work with HD in YUV and RGB space as well in real time.
The Flame is equipped with a lot of plug-ins (Sapphire, Furnace) to make very spectaculars special effects.
*) For simpler HD editing we installed two softwares from DVS: one Clipster and one Pronto. As they have a big background disk memory we also use them as a player and a recorder for the DI grading sessions.
They are also ideal for different transcoding jobs like down and up converting (HD to SD or vice versa) and system transcoding (PAL – NYSC).
